Obesity is generally defined as 30 or more pounds over a healthy weight. A recent study of obesity reports 27.5% of a random sample of 400 adults in the United States to be obese.
a. Use this sample information to compute the 90% confidence interval for the adult obesity rate in the United States.
b. Is it reasonable to conclude with 90% confidence that the adult obesity rate in the United States differs from 30%?
